Possible disadvantages of MoonPay

  • High Fees
    MoonPay charges relatively high fees for its services, which can be a drawback for users looking to minimize costs in their cryptocurrency transactions.
  • Limited Availability in Some Regions
    The service is not available in all countries, potentially limiting access for users based in regions where MoonPay is not operational.
  • Customer Support Issues
    Some users have reported difficulties in reaching MoonPay's customer support, which can be frustrating for those encountering issues or needing assistance.
  • Regulatory Compliance Concerns
    As with many cryptocurrency services, users may have concerns about MoonPay's compliance with local regulations, which can affect the platform's availability and use in certain areas.
  • Identity Verification Requirements
    MoonPay requires thorough identity verification processes, which can be time-consuming and may deter potential users who value privacy.
